Income Tax (Earnings and Pensions) Act 2003

Paragraph 58: Matching shares: introduction

3129.This paragraph is introductory, setting out the requirements that a SIP must meet if it provides for matching shares. It derives from paragraph 49 of Schedule 8..

3130.This paragraph lists the requirements contained in the following paragraphs of Part 7 of this Schedule, introducing the individual paragraphs that will follow (as in paragraph 6 of Schedule 8) as opposed to stating that the plan “must comply with the requirements of this Part of this Schedule” (as in paragraph 49 of Schedule 8).

Explanatory Notes

Text created by the government department responsible for the subject matter of the Act to explain what the Act sets out to achieve and to make the Act accessible to readers who are not legally qualified. Explanatory Notes were introduced in 1999 and accompany all Public Acts except Appropriation, Consolidated Fund, Finance and Consolidation Acts.
